Introduction to Whale Wallets

Whale wallets, which are typically defined as wallets holding over 1,000 BTC or 100,000 ETH, have a significant impact on the cryptocurrency market. These large holders can influence market trends and prices through their buying and selling activities.

According to CryptoReportKit's DataLab, the top 100 whale wallets hold approximately 12% of the total Bitcoin supply, highlighting their substantial market presence. By analyzing the movements of these wallets, investors can gain valuable insights into market trends and potential price shifts.

For instance, in 2022, a single whale wallet was responsible for a 10% price surge in Ethereum after purchasing over 50,000 ETH in a single transaction.

On-Chain Accumulation Signals

On-chain accumulation signals refer to the buying and holding activities of whale wallets, which can be tracked using blockchain data. By analyzing these signals, investors can identify potential market trends and make informed decisions.

Actionable Insights for Investors

By monitoring on-chain accumulation signals and whale wallet movements, investors can gain valuable insights into market trends and potential price shifts. For instance, if a large whale wallet is accumulating a significant amount of a particular cryptocurrency, it may indicate a potential price surge.

It's essential to note that while on-chain accumulation signals and whale wallet movements can provide valuable insights, they should not be used as the sole basis for investment decisions. A comprehensive investment strategy should consider multiple factors, including market trends, technical analysis, and fundamental analysis.

Investors should always conduct thorough research and consider multiple factors before making investment decisions.
